## Signing the Tidybranch Bot Releases

The Tidybranch stale-branch cleanup bot runs with elevated repo permissions, so every build must be signed before the Hollowgate scheduler will load it. Support team: if a customer reports the bot skipping branches, first confirm the running build's signature matches the published release. Signatures are produced at release time with the key listed directly below.

rollout seal: bky4_x7Gc

14:22 — Offline sync regression confirmed (Terrapath field-survey app)

At 14:22 the on-call engineer reproduced the data-loss path: surveys saved while offline were marked synced once connectivity returned, even when the upload was rejected. The queue flush skipped the server acknowledgement check introduced in the previous sprint. Release manager note: the fix must ship before the coastal survey season. The offending build is identified by the token recorded below.

session token of kawif-fawig = htk31_f3f599be2b1a34affb1efa8d0feccf8

Action item from the Mirewater tide-table widget incident. Owner: release manager. Widget cached stale harbor offsets after the DST change, showing tides six hours off for two days. Required: add a cache-invalidation check to the release checklist, block deploys when offset tables are older than 24 hours, and verify the Saltgate harbor feed before each cut. Deadline: next release. Checklist template and sign-off procedure are documented on the internal page below.

wiki page, kawif-bajep: https://artifactory.zarqelforge.internal/issue/browse/display/display/projects/spaces/secrets/000fe6ec5a46af29355003e1

**Mgmt Meeting Minutes — Retiring the Brightline Range**

Quick recap for sales leads at Fenholt Supplies: we agreed to retire the Brightline fixture range by year-end. Remaining stock moves to clearance pricing next month, and accounts on standing orders get migrated to the Lumetta range. Trade-in incentives were approved in principle. The confidential note on next steps sits just below.

board note of bajof-bajeg: The pricing group signed off on a budget of $13.4 million for Project Sildor. The renewal with Lamixek Holdings closes at $48.9 million a year, 49 percent above the last contract.